The Atlanta design community is mourning the heartbreaking loss of MacKenzie Johnson, a beloved longtime member of the Atlanta Decorative Arts Center family whose passing has left colleagues, friends, clients, and loved ones grieving deeply. Her death marks the loss of a woman remembered not only for her professional dedication, but for the warmth, compassion, and genuine kindness that made her such an unforgettable presence within Atlanta’s creative community. In a heartfelt statement shared by the Atlanta Decorative Arts Center, colleagues described MacKenzie as an irreplaceable part of the organization and someone who helped shape the spirit of the design center over nearly two decades. Those who worked alongside her say she brought energy, grace, and authenticity into every interaction, building relationships that extended far beyond the workplace.
